Forward Partners, established in 2013, is a London-based venture capital firm specializing in early-stage investments. It focuses on pre-seed and seed-stage technology startups, particularly in eCommerce, marketplaces, Web3, and applied AI sectors.

Unbound
Seed Round in 2013
Unbound is an award-winning online crowd-funded publisher that enables authors to present their book ideas directly to potential readers. Readers can pledge their support for these ideas, and once a book garners sufficient backing, the author proceeds to write it. Unbound then handles the editing, typesetting, printing, and distribution of the completed work. This innovative model not only allows for the publication of diverse fiction and non-fiction works but also ensures that the names of all subscribers who contributed to the book's success are acknowledged. Through this approach, Unbound aims to create a more engaging and participatory publishing experience for both authors and readers.

Skimlinks
Venture Round in 2013
Skimlinks is a leading commerce content monetization platform that enables publishers to diversify their revenue streams, reducing reliance on traditional advertising. By utilizing Skimlinks' technology, publishers automatically earn a share of sales generated from monetized product links embedded in their commerce-related content. This system allows readers to click on these links, leading to purchases that generate revenue for the publishers. Skimlinks provides access to over 60 affiliate networks, facilitating commission earnings from approximately 27,000 merchants worldwide. In 2017, the platform's annual e-commerce transactions exceeded $1 billion. The company counts many prominent clients among its users, including some of the top publishers in the US and UK, such as Conde Nast, Hearst, and Buzzfeed. Skimlinks continuously develops innovative solutions to enhance click-through rates and earnings per click for its users.

Hailo Network
Series A in 2012
Hailo is a developer of a smartphone application that facilitates taxi services by connecting riders with licensed taxi drivers through an online marketplace. The app allows users to arrange rides and make payments seamlessly. Originally established as a leading taxi app in the UK and Ireland, Hailo merged with mytaxi in 2016, which later became part of FREE NOW, a prominent mobility provider operating in various cities across the UK. This merger was a strategic move to enhance their presence in the e-hailing market, aiming to become a key player in Europe's transportation landscape.

Kirusa
Series B in 2006
Kirusa, Inc. is a mobile value-added services provider, specializing in voice messaging and social media applications for mobile carriers and subscribers, particularly in emerging markets across Africa, the Middle East, South and Southeast Asia, and Eastern Europe. Founded in 2001 and headquartered in New Providence, New Jersey, Kirusa offers a range of products, including voice SMS solutions, cloud-based services, and managed services. Its offerings, such as the InstaVoice platform, enable users to send and receive voice messages and calls over data networks and integrate social media functionalities, allowing subscribers to connect with friends and family globally. Kirusa also provides enterprise solutions for interactive mobile and social media marketing. The company maintains sales offices in Paris, Delhi, and Abu Dhabi, along with research and development facilities in New Delhi and Bangalore, India.
